GPT-5.5

GPT-5.5 was introduced by OpenAI as a major step toward more autonomous, intent-aware assistance on real-world tasks. Rather than waiting for step-by-step prompts, the model is designed to interpret what a user is trying to accomplish, plan a path through ambiguous or messy multi-part requests, and carry work forward across tools until a result is produced. This positioning reflects a broader shift in how the model is meant to be used: handing off larger jobs and trusting the system to navigate that quick-info value, check intermediate results, and keep going when problems arise.

The strongest reported gains sit in agentic coding, computer use, knowledge work, and early scientific research, where progress depends on reasoning across long that quick-info value windows and taking sustained action over time. OpenAI highlights particular strengths in writing and debugging code, online research, data analysis, and producing documents and spreadsheets. GPT-5.5 and GPT-5.5 Pro became available through the API shortly after launch, accompanied by a system card documenting additional safeguards, signaling a model aimed at practitioners who want a single, high-capability assistant for end-to-end professional workflows.
